Day-to-Day Expectations will include:
- Managing a team of up to 10 technicians at our Hazel Green location.
- Hiring and executing training procedures for new and existing employees.
- Evaluating performance and providing ongoing training.
- Utilizing our CRM system to manage and update customer information.
- Staying up to date with industry trends, product knowledge, and company offerings to effectively communicate with customers.
Requirements
- High school diploma or equivalent.
- Excellent communication and employee developmental skills.
- Ability to work independently, manage time effectively, and manage a team.
- Goal-oriented with a strong work ethic and a results-driven mindset.
- Proven track record as a successful people manager, leading a team of 5 or more
